Note: We have organized the cemeteries in our Gazetteer based on a problem that we had while working on our own genealogy. As an example and without specifying the cemeteries involved, we found an ancestor that we believed to have been buried in one cemetery had actually been buried elsewhere.
We discovered that his burial plans had changed at the last moment and the family had scrambled to make new arrangements. By looking at nearby cemeteries, the surrounding communities and in newspapers of the period, we were finally able to locate his burial site.
Should you find yourself in the same situation, we hope that our Gazetteer helps you discover your lost ancestor.
The Location of the Naylor Cemetery ...
We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Naylor Cemetery:
40.3104, -88.3855
Note: While we are using the above GPS location for the Naylor Cemetery, it has not been verified and we are uncertain about its accuracy - use with caution.
The Naylor Cemetery is located less than 2 miles<2> to the west of Fisher.
The cemetery is located in Champaign County<3>.
The county seat for Champaign County is located in Urbana. Urbana lies 16 miles [25.7 km] to the southeast of the Naylor Cemetery .

Name Variations for Naylor Cemetery ...
When doing your research, keep in mind that names and their spelling can change over time. Various errors happen - anything from simple spelling to bad translations.
Naylor Cemetery has also been known as:
- United Brethren Church Cemetery
